Dolomite is a flux stone, meaning it has twice the material value an can be used in the production of steel.


Real Life Information


Dolomite is a mineral and stone comprised of Calcium-Magnesium Carbonate (CaMg(CO3)2), and is related to Limestone, Chalk and Marble.
